How much do operator helper j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average hourly pay for operator helper in Oceanside, CA is $18.62,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.40 and $19.90 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an operator helper?

Operator Helpers assist machine operators, technicians, or skilled workers in manufacturing, construction, or production environments. Their duties often include preparing materials, maintaining equipment, cleaning work areas, and helping ensure smooth operation of machinery. They play a vital role in supporting workflow, reducing downtime, and keeping the workplace safe and efficient. Operator Helpers typically work under direct supervision and may advance to more specialized roles with exper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an operator helper,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Operator Helper, you need a basic understanding of machinery operation, safety protocols,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with industrial equipment, hand tools, and sometimes forklift certification are commonly required. Attention to detail, teamwork, and reliability are crucial soft skills for supporting operators and maintaining a safe work environment. These abilities ensure smooth production processes, minimize downtime, and contribute to overall workplace safety and efficiency.

What are some common challenges operator helpers face on the job, and how can they overcome them?

Operator Helpers often encounter challenges such as adapting to fast-paced environments, maintaining safety standards, and learning to operate different types of machinery. To overcome these challenges, it's important to be proactive in communicating with team members, strictly follow safety protocols, and seek out on-the-job training opportunities. Building strong relationships with experienced operators can also help new Operator Helpers gain valuable insights and hands-on experience, making it easier to navigate daily responsibilities and advance within the team.

What is the difference between Operator Helper vs Equipment Operator?

AspectOperator HelperEquipment Operator
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job trainingHigh school diploma or equivalent; certifications may be preferred
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, factories, or industrial settings assisting equipment operatorsConstruction sites, factories, or industrial settings operating heavy machinery
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across construction, manufacturing, and industrial sectors as support staffUsed in similar sectors but with responsibility for operating machinery
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level support roles in machinery operationLearning about operating heavy equipment and related roles

The main difference between an Operator Helper and an Equipment Operator is that the Helper assists with supporting tasks and does not operate heavy machinery independently, while the Equipment Operator is responsible for operating and controlling machinery directly. Both roles are essential in industrial and construction environments, but they differ in responsibilities and skill requirements.

Job description

Overview:

Our team has developed a strong culture of safety, professionalism, and personal responsibility. Transdev's Autonomous Mobility & Fleet Specialists are critical to the success of delivering safe autonomous driving systems to our customers, enabling a revolutionary mobility experience.

This dynamic role encompasses autonomous vehicle operations, fleet logistics, and field recovery. If hired into this position, you will be trained across multiple functions and may be deployed in any of these capacities depending on operational needs. You will be responsible for operating and evaluating self-driving vehicles, providing ride-hail services to the general public, and executing safe roadside recovery operations.

It is important to maintain a high level of professionalism and responsibility when critiquing a new operator’s driving abilities. Safety is our #1 responsibility. Level 2 Operators are expected to uphold this standard in all situations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Maintain Transdev's high standard of safety, situational awareness, and professionalism inside and outside of the vehicle at all times.
  • Consistently demonstrate superior situational awareness, a deep understanding of the proprietary technology in your care, and a proactive willingness to constantly adjust to rapid changes in the operational environment.
  • Safely operate and evaluate vehicles in both autonomous and manual modes, demonstrating proficiency in manual transmission driving, across defined routes, undefined routes, and closed-course facilities under various environmental conditions.
  • Monitor multiple software systems and onboard data recording computers with constant focus.
  • Provide concise, clear, and accurate verbal and written feedback, daily reports, and documentation regarding vehicle operations, software releases, and recurring bugs.
  • Ride comfortably as a passenger in an autonomous vehicle where the operator may have little to no control over the vehicle's operations.
  • Coordinate vehicle batch setups prior to shift arrivals, ensuring the fleet is clean and fully prepared for daily missions.
  • Follow established diagnostic guides to troubleshoot driver support modules (including laptops, mobile devices, and monitoring cameras), and communicate clearly with technical support for escalation.
  • Assist as a spotter to guide vehicle movements inside and outside of depots, parking spots, and remote locations.
  • Oversee asset security processes, including managing vehicle keys, accounting for data disks, and ensuring only badged personnel access vehicle areas and remote sites.
  • Safely operate a non-autonomous vehicle to monitor driverless vehicle locations in the field and respond quickly to recovery or rescue situations.
  • Execute safe vehicle recovery operations, including parking defensively behind a driverless vehicle, setting up scene protection, disengaging autonomous software, and driving the car to a safe location.
  • Deliver exceptional customer service and roadside assistance to passengers of a driverless vehicle, helping them safely disembark, board a rescue vehicle, and travel to their destination.
  • Act as a polite, professional representative and point of contact for the public, client guests, security, and facilities staff at remote operational sites.
  • Work flexibly, either individually or in small teams, and adapt quickly to shifting operational demands, modified schedules, or new technologies.
  • All other duties as assigned.

Pre-Employment Requirements:

  • Must be at least 21 years of age.
  • Must possess and maintain a valid driver's license and a clean driving record that meets state Autonomous Vehicle Tester (AVT) regulations (e.g., no more than 1 point on a CA record, or no more than one non-major moving violation in the preceding 3 years). Driving records are continuously reviewed in accordance with local and state regulations to ensure ongoing compliance.
  • No driver's license suspensions or revocations due to operating a vehicle under the influence of alcohol or drugs within the last 10 years.
  • Never have been the at-fault driver in a motor vehicle accident that resulted in injury or death.
  • Ability to qualify for and maintain an Autonomous Vehicle Tester (AVT) license/permit (in states where required), defensive driving certifications, and remain in good standing per company safety point policies.
  • Satisfactory completion of a pre-employment background check, drug screen, and physical screening.
